Um, Fi didn't die in SS. Link did not kill her. Seriously why do people keep believing that Fi is dead after SS? All Link did was put the Master Sword into the pedestal, thus putting Fi to sleep. It's literally no different than when Link found her in the first place when the Goddess Sword was in the pedestal in the Isle of the Goddess.

So, saying that Fi died simply by the Master Sword being put into a pedestal pretty much contradicts her presence in the first place, seeing as how putting the Goddess Sword in a pedestal and raising the isle with the Goddess Sword into the Sky didn't harm her at all.
